Roth Ira Calculator
Roth Ira Calculator
Results
A Roth IRA calculator estimates the future value of contributions made to a Roth Individual Retirement Account, illustrating the potential effects of compound growth over time within a tax-advantaged structure. It answers the question of what an investor’s balance might become given specific annual contributions, an assumed rate of return, and a defined investment period. This tool differs from a general compound interest calculator by incorporating IRS-governed contribution limits, income eligibility phase-outs, and the unique feature of tax-free qualified withdrawals. Users operate these calculators to model retirement planning horizons spanning decades, test contribution strategies against annual limits, and project the magnitude of tax-free growth relative to taxable brokerage accounts.
Roth IRA calculators transform user inputs—initial balance, periodic contribution amount, expected annual rate of return, investment time horizon, and sometimes federal tax rates—into a projected future account balance. The core logic applies a compound interest formula to the starting balance and each periodic contribution. Contributions are typically modeled as occurring at either the beginning or end of each compounding period, affecting the final balance. Critically, the calculator assumes all growth within the account accumulates free of federal taxes and that qualified withdrawals of both contributions and earnings are also tax-free. The model projects balances forward through monthly or annual increments until the target age or year, summing all contributions and calculated growth.
A Roth IRA calculator provides estimated future values based on inputs you supply. These projections rely on a fixed average annual rate of return, which cannot account for real-world market volatility. Actual investment returns fluctuate yearly, and the order of those returns—sequence risk—significantly impacts portfolio value during the withdrawal phase, a factor these tools do not model. Calculators also typically use a net return figure. If you input a 7% return, it must already include the deduction of estimated investment fees, as most calculators do not separately factor in ongoing expense ratios or advisor fees that reduce net growth.
For example, a calculator might project a $100,000 balance growing at 7% annually for 20 years. It assumes that precise return each year. In reality, a period of severe losses early in those 20 years, followed by the same average return, would result in a lower ending balance than projected. Similarly, a 1% annual fee would turn a 7% gross return into a 6% net return; over 20 years, that fee could reduce the final balance by tens of thousands of dollars, an effect hidden if the input rate is not adjusted.
Annual and Catch-Up Contribution Limits
For 2025, the annual contribution limit for a Roth IRA is $7,000 for individuals under age 50. The catch-up contribution limit for individuals aged 50 and older is an additional $1,000, making their total limit $8,000. These limits are aggregate across all IRAs an individual holds. They are subject to periodic adjustment by the IRS for inflation. A calculator must constrain input contributions to these maximums to produce a legally feasible projection.
Income Eligibility and Phase-Out Ranges
Eligibility to contribute directly to a Roth IRA is subject to modified adjusted gross income (MAGI) limits. For 2025, the phase-out range for single filers and heads of household is MAGI between $146,000 and $161,000. For married couples filing jointly, the phase-out range is MAGI between $230,000 and $240,000. Within these ranges, the maximum allowable contribution is reduced proportionally. A calculator incorporating income inputs must apply this reduction algorithm. For MAGI above the top of the range, no direct contribution is permitted, though a backdoor Roth IRA strategy may remain an option.
Compounding Frequency Assumptions
Compound frequency—how often earned interest or investment returns are calculated and added to the principal—significantly impacts growth projections. Most online calculators default to annual compounding for simplicity, though actual investment accounts may compound dividends or interest daily, monthly, or quarterly. A sophisticated model allows users to select the compounding period, adjusting the periodic rate and the number of compounding events accordingly.
Contribution Timing (Beginning vs. End of Period)
Whether contributions are modeled as made at the start of each period (annuity due) or at the end (ordinary annuity) alters the outcome. A $7,000 contribution invested at the beginning of the year has an additional year to grow compared to one made at the end. Over decades, this timing difference can result in a meaningful variance in the final balance.
Inflation-Adjusted (Real) vs. Nominal Growth
Calculators may present results in nominal terms, showing today’s dollar projections, or in inflation-adjusted terms, showing future balances in the purchasing power of today’s dollars. An inflation-adjusted projection uses a real rate of return, which is the nominal expected return minus an assumed inflation rate. This provides a more practical view of potential retirement spending power.
Tax-Free Withdrawal Mechanics
Qualified distributions from a Roth IRA are entirely tax-free. A qualified distribution requires the account holder to be at least age 59½ and to have held a Roth IRA for at least five taxable years. Calculators emphasizing Roth benefits often contrast the projected tax-free balance with the after-tax value of a taxable account where dividends and capital gains are taxed annually.
Five-Year Rule Handling
Two separate five-year rules exist. The first governs tax-free earnings withdrawals: five taxable years must pass after the first contribution to any Roth IRA before earnings can be withdrawn tax-free, provided other conditions are met. The second applies to conversions: each converted amount from a traditional IRA has its own five-year holding period to avoid a 10% penalty, though taxes are paid at conversion. Few calculators model these rules dynamically, instead stating them as constraints on withdrawal eligibility.
Early Withdrawal Penalties and Exceptions
Distributions of earnings before age 59½ that are not qualified are subject to a 10% early withdrawal penalty and ordinary income taxes. Exceptions to the penalty include first-time home purchases (up to $10,000 lifetime), qualified higher education expenses, certain medical costs, and disability. Contributions, however, can be withdrawn at any time, for any reason, tax- and penalty-free, as they were made with after-tax dollars. Accurate calculators note this ordering rule: contributions are always deemed withdrawn first.
Employer Plan Interaction Misconceptions
Participation in an employer-sponsored retirement plan like a 401(k) does not affect an individual’s eligibility to contribute to a Roth IRA. Income limits for Roth IRA contributions apply regardless of workplace plan participation. This is a common point of confusion distinct from the rules governing deductibility of traditional IRA contributions.
Roth IRA vs. Traditional IRA Comparisons
A comparative calculator highlights the fundamental trade-off: Roth IRA contributions are made with after-tax dollars, providing tax-free growth and withdrawals, while traditional IRA contributions may be tax-deductible, providing tax-deferred growth with taxable withdrawals. The outcome often hinges on the user’s current versus expected future tax bracket. Most comparison tools project both future balances and the after-tax spendable income, assuming a tax rate at withdrawal.
Conversion Scenarios and Limitations
A Roth IRA conversion involves moving assets from a traditional IRA, SEP IRA, or SIMPLE IRA into a Roth IRA. The converted amount is taxable as ordinary income in the year of conversion. Calculators for this scenario project whether the long-term tax-free growth outweighs the immediate tax cost. They must account for the impact of the conversion itself pushing the taxpayer into a higher tax bracket. The pro-rata rule, which applies if the investor holds any pre-tax dollars in any traditional IRA, complicates these calculations and is frequently omitted from simple tools.
Future Value Formula
The fundamental formula for the future value of a series of periodic contributions with compound growth is the future value of an annuity. The specific form depends on contribution timing.
For contributions made at the end of each period (ordinary annuity):
FV = P × (1 + r)^n - 1 / r
For contributions made at the beginning of each period (annuity due):
FV = P × (1 + r)^n - 1 / r × (1 + r)
When an existing starting balance (BB) is included, its separate growth is added:
FVtotal = B × (1 + r)^n + FVcontributions
Variable Definitions
- FV: Future Value of the contributions or total account balance.
- P: Periodic contribution amount (e.g., annual contribution).
- r: Periodic interest rate (e.g., annual rate of return divided by compounding periods per year). For annual compounding, this is simply the annual rate.
- n: Total number of compounding periods (e.g., years to retirement multiplied by compounding periods per year).
- B: Initial account balance at the start of the calculation.
Assumptions
- The rate of return (r) is constant and compounded at the specified frequency.
- Contributions (P) are made uniformly at the specified time within each period.
- No taxes are levied on investment growth within the account.
- All IRS contribution limits are adhered to; the formula does not enforce them automatically.
- Withdrawals are not modeled during the accumulation phase.
Contribution Amount
Enter the dollar amount you plan to contribute each year. The calculator should reject inputs exceeding the IRS annual limit ($7,000 for under 50, $8,000 for 50+ in 2025) or should dynamically reduce it if an income phase-out is also modeled.
Contribution Frequency
Select whether contributions are made annually, monthly, or bi-weekly. This setting adjusts the periodic contribution amount (P) and the compounding frequency (n and r) in the underlying formula.
Expected Annual Rate of Return
Enter a projected percentage for annual investment growth. This is an assumption, not a guarantee. Historical market averages, often cited for context, range from 6% to 10% nominal for equities, but future returns are uncertain. Using a conservative estimate (e.g., 5-6%) is common.
Investment Duration / Current & Retirement Age
Input the number of years until withdrawal, often derived by subtracting your current age from your planned retirement age. This defines the variable n in the formula. A longer horizon dramatically amplifies compounding effects.
Current Account Balance
Input any existing savings already within a Roth IRA. This is treated as the starting principal (B) that will compound over the entire period.
Income & Tax Filing Status
For an advanced calculator, inputs for modified adjusted gross income (MAGI) and tax filing status (single, married filing jointly) are required. The tool uses these to calculate any reduction in the allowable contribution amount via the phase-out rules, adjusting the effective P used in the calculation.
Final Balance
This is the projected total value (FVtotal) in the Roth IRA at the target retirement date. It represents the sum of all contributions and the compounded investment growth.
Total Contributions
This sum is the cumulative out-of-pocket capital invested (P × n) plus any starting balance. In a Roth IRA, this amount has already been taxed and can always be withdrawn without further tax or penalty.
Total Investment Growth
Calculated as the Final Balance minus Total Contributions. This figure represents the tax-free investment earnings accumulated over the period. It is the primary benefit the calculator seeks to illustrate.
Tax Treatment Implications
A proper output section explicitly states that, assuming qualified distributions, the entire final balance is available for withdrawal without federal income tax. Some calculators may contrast this with the after-tax value of a taxable account, where capital gains and dividends are taxed periodically.
Common Misinterpretations
The projected growth is not guaranteed; actual returns will vary, potentially negatively. The calculator does not verify annual eligibility; a user whose income later enters the phase-out range may be unable to contribute the modeled amount. The results do not constitute a promise of future wealth or retirement income adequacy.
Scenario 1: Early-Career Contributor
A 25-year-old with a $0 starting balance plans to retire at 65. They contribute the maximum annual amount for someone under 50, which is $7,000 in 2025 terms, at the start of each year. Assuming a 7% nominal annual rate of return compounded annually:
Using the annuity due formula for 40 years: P = 7000, r = 0.07, n = 40 FV = 7000 × (1.07)^40 - 1 / 0.07 × 1.07
The future value of contributions is approximately $1,366,145. Total contributions are $280,000 ($7,000 x 40). Total tax-free growth is approximately $1,086,145.
Scenario 2: Late Starter Using Catch-Up Contributions
A 55-year-old begins with a $100,000 rollover balance and plans to retire at 72. They will make the maximum catch-up contribution of $8,000 annually at year-end. Assuming a more conservative 5% annual return:
B = 100,000, P = 8000, r = 0.05, n = 17 Growth on starting balance: Future value of contributions (ordinary annuity): Final Balance: Total Contributions: Total Growth:
Scenario 3: High-Income User Exceeding Eligibility Thresholds
A single filer in 2025 with a MAGI of $155,000 wishes to contribute. This income is within the phase-out range ($146,000 to $161,000). The allowable contribution is reduced proportionally:
Reduction fraction = (155,000 - 146,000) / (15,000) = 0.6 or 60% reduction Maximum allowable contribution = ...
A calculator with income logic would use $2,800 as the effective P, not the full $7,000. If the user incorrectly modeled the full contribution, the projection would be invalid.
All models are constrained by their inputs and simplifications. A critical limitation is the assumption of a constant annual return, which does not reflect market volatility, sequence of returns risk, or the potential for extended bear markets. Regulatory uncertainty exists; IRS contribution limits, income thresholds, and tax laws can change, altering the calculator's relevance. Personal circumstances like job loss, disability, or changing income can disrupt contribution plans. The calculator typically assumes uninterrupted, maximum contributions, which may not be realistic. Early withdrawals, even of contributions, can reduce the ending balance in unmodeled ways. Rollovers from other accounts may be subject to the five-year rule for conversions, a nuance often excluded. Calculators do not provide asset allocation guidance or account for investment fees, which reduce net returns.
A Roth IRA calculator is a specialized subset of retirement and compound interest tools. A general compound interest calculator can model growth but lacks IRS rule integration. A Traditional IRA calculator projects tax-deferred growth but must estimate taxes on withdrawal, requiring an assumption about future tax rates. A comprehensive retirement planner incorporates multiple account types (401(k), taxable), Social Security, and inflation to estimate income replacement. Roth vs. 401(k) calculators weigh employer match benefits against future tax treatment. A backdoor Roth IRA calculator must incorporate the pro-rata rule and the tax impact of conversion. Each tool serves a distinct but related analytical purpose.
A well-designed Roth IRA calculator performs all computations locally within the user's browser (client-side) or displays results without transmitting personal financial data to a server. No personally identifiable information, such as name, Social Security number, or exact account balances, should be required or stored. Users should verify a website's privacy policy to understand data collection practices. For optimal security, use calculators on secure (HTTPS) websites and avoid inputting excessively detailed personal information. The calculations themselves use publicly available mathematical formulas and do not require sensitive data to function.
How to Use the Roth IRA Calculator
- Enter your current age and planned retirement age to define the investment duration.
- Input your current Roth IRA balance, if any.
- Enter your annual contribution amount, ensuring it does not exceed IRS limits for your age.
- Select the expected annual rate of return as a percentage.
- Provide your marginal tax rate to compare Roth IRA results with a taxable account.
- Choose whether contributions are made yearly or monthly.
- Click Calculate to view projected balances, tax savings, and growth over time.
Frequently Asked Questions (FAQ)
What is a Roth IRA calculator?
A Roth IRA calculator is a digital tool that projects the potential future value of regular contributions to a Roth IRA, based on input variables like contribution amount, time horizon, and expected rate of return, while accounting for the account's tax-free growth characteristics.
How does a Roth IRA calculator differ from a regular savings calculator?
It incorporates specific rules for Roth IRAs, such as annual contribution limits, income eligibility phase-outs, and the assumption of tax-free qualified withdrawals, which a general savings calculator does not consider.
What is the five-year rule?
Two rules exist. For qualified tax-free withdrawals of earnings, the account holder must be over 59½ and the Roth IRA must have been open for at least five taxable years. For conversions from a traditional IRA, each converted amount must remain in the Roth IRA for five years to avoid the 10% early withdrawal penalty if withdrawn.
Can I contribute to a Roth IRA if I have a 401(k) at work?
Yes, participation in an employer-sponsored plan like a 401(k) does not prohibit you from contributing to a Roth IRA. Your ability to contribute is determined solely by your modified adjusted gross income (MAGI) relative to IRS phase-out ranges.
What happens if my income is too high for a direct Roth IRA contribution?
You may be ineligible for direct contributions but could execute a backdoor Roth IRA strategy. This involves making a non-deductible contribution to a traditional IRA and then converting that balance to a Roth IRA, though tax implications exist if you have other pre-tax IRA assets.
How do I estimate my rate of return for the calculator?
Use a conservative, long-term historical average for a balanced portfolio, often between 5% and 7% after inflation for a real return. Using a higher rate creates an optimistic projection that may not be realistic.
Does the calculator account for taxes on withdrawals?
A Roth IRA calculator assumes withdrawals are qualified and thus tax-free. It does not apply any tax to the final balance, which is the defining feature of the Roth structure.
What is the penalty for early withdrawal?
Earnings withdrawn before age 59½ and before meeting the five-year rule are subject to ordinary income tax and a 10% penalty. Your own contributions can be withdrawn at any time, tax- and penalty-free.
Are Roth IRA contributions tax-deductible?
No. Roth IRA contributions are made with after-tax dollars. The tax benefit comes later in the form of tax-free growth and qualified withdrawals.
Where can I find the official IRS contribution limits and income ranges?
The Internal Revenue Service (IRS) publishes these figures annually in Publication 590-A, "Contributions to Individual Retirement Arrangements (IRAs)." The limits are also announced via IRS news releases and noted on the IRS website.
Should I adjust my expected rate of return in the calculator to account for fees?
Yes. Use a net return estimate. If you expect a 7% gross return from investments but pay 1% in fees, use 6% as your input rate to better reflect the growth your portfolio will actually experience.
Disclaimer
This content is for informational and educational purposes only. It does not constitute financial, tax, or legal advice. Model projections are hypothetical, based on assumptions, and are not guarantees of future performance. Tax rules are complex and subject to change. Consult a qualified financial advisor, tax professional, or the Internal Revenue Service (IRS) for guidance specific to your individual circumstances.